Abstract

BNP is increasingly utilized in the management of pediatric HT recipients. Performing a retrospective single-center chart review, we sought to describe BNP changes during the first year after HT and identify factors that affect its trend. After exclusion for rejection, 316 BNP levels from 50 patients were evaluated. BNP underwent an exponential decline 120 days after HT followed by a plateau. Log10 BNP decline strongly correlated with time (r = -0.70, p < 0.0001). Initial BNP was less in pretransplant VAD (p = 0.0016) and lower post-HT inotrope use (p = 0.0043). Infant recipients, IT >4 h, and those bridged medically were associated with higher plateau BNP. Multivariable logistic regression demonstrated IT >4 h independently predicted plateau BNP in the upper quartile (OR 7.1, p = 0.02). No significant change in BNP coincided with rejection (N = 6 patients) without severe hemodynamic compromise. BNP correlated modestly with right atrial pressure (r = 0.4652, p < 0.0001) and pulmonary capillary wedge pressure (r = 0.2660, p < 0.001), but poorly with echocardiogram (r = -0.18, p = 0.003). Trending BNP could help provide insight into how the graft recovers after HT and IT >4 h independently predicted higher plateau BNP and may reflect subtle changes in graft performance.

摘要

脑钠肽(BNP)在小儿心脏移植(HT)受者的管理中应用越来越多。通过进行一项回顾性单中心病历审查,我们试图描述HT后第一年期间BNP的变化,并确定影响其变化趋势的因素。排除排斥反应后,对50例患者的316个BNP水平进行了评估。HT后120天,BNP呈指数下降,随后趋于平稳。Log10BNP下降与时间密切相关(r = -0.70,p < 0.0001)。移植前使用心室辅助装置(VAD)时初始BNP较低(p = 0.0016),HT后使用血管活性药物时BNP较低(p = 0.0043)。婴儿受者、缺血时间(IT)>4小时以及那些接受药物过渡的患者,其平稳期BNP较高。多变量逻辑回归显示,IT>4小时独立预测了平稳期BNP处于上四分位数(比值比7.1,p = 0.02)。在无严重血流动力学损害的排斥反应患者中(n = 6例),BNP无显著变化。BNP与右心房压力(r = 0.4652,p < 0.0001)和肺毛细血管楔压(r = 0.2660,p < 0.001)呈中度相关,但与超声心动图相关性较差(r = -0.18,p = 0.003)。监测BNP变化有助于深入了解HT后移植物的恢复情况,IT>4小时独立预测了较高的平稳期BNP,可能反映了移植物功能的细微变化。
